It was 17 when I left at 8 this am. I had Gerbing jacket liner, pants liner, gloves & just got the insoles. I rode a half hour to meet a buddy for breakfast. Then headed west for 55 miles on I-66 and US17 to Berryville VA. Gear was great - no cold spots. In Berryville I had to adjust my visor snaps -- a good old boy in a pickup pulled up and said, "Heh man, its 24 degrees, are you cold?" I yelled -- NO, FEELS GREAT ! Got home about 1245 with a total of 127 miles. INSOLES are a necessary addition to my Danner 600 Gram. BTSOOM
